Rydal Street is a street almost entirely of terraced houses. The median sale price is £56,500, about 64% below the typical WN7 sale. Per square metre of floor space it comes to about £822, below the district's £1,944. Recent sales here have been outpacing the wider WN7 market. The record shows 84 sales across 42 homes since 2000.

Rydal Street's £56,500 median sits about 64% below WN7's £154,995; on floor space it runs £822/m² against the district's £1,944/m² (-58%).
Street and WN7 figures are medians of HM Land Registry sales; the England figures are the UK House Price Index mix-adjusted average — a different basis, so compare direction rather than levels between the two.

Sales marked non-standardare Land Registry “additional price paid” entries — bulk purchases, repossessions, right-to-buy and similar transfers. They're listed for completeness but excluded from every median and comparison figure on this page.
